Faculty: Our interaction with professors and assistant professors is kind of limited. You are dealing with senior residents and PGs. They are helpful. The majority of the lectures are like someone walking in, reading a PPT, and leaving. The curriculum is good, with an emphasis on practical learning. Semester exams are difficult to pass, but they are not the major ones. TThe major exams are called professional exams and are held once a year.
